API使用不当导致错误:Java JDBC连接池原理及实践
Java JDBC(Java Database Connectivity)是Java与数据库交互的标准机制。如果API使用不当,确实会导致各种错误。以下是一些常见的问题和解决方法:
连接池为空:
如果没有设置连接池,当需要获取数据库连接时,就会报错。
解决方案:在项目中引入并配置JDBC连接池。连接失效:
如果JDBC连接的超时时间设定得过短,可能会导致连接无法正常使用而失效。
解决方案:合理设置JDBC连接的超时时间和重试次数。SQL语法错误:
如果在API调用中直接拼写了SQL语句,且其中包含不符合数据库规范的字符,就会报错。
解决方案:使用预编译的SQL语句(PreparedStatement),并确保传入的数据符合SQL要求。
以上就是Java JDBC连接池原理及实践过程中可能出现的一些错误及其解决方法。希望对你理解API使用和解决JDBC问题有所帮助。
还没有评论,来说两句吧...